Dial and Hands
The silver dial is executed with a subtle vertical brushed texture that interacts beautifully with the light. It features heavy, faceted applied block indices that add depth and dimension to the face. The signature Rado anchor logo rotates freely against a red background at the 12 o'clock position, while the rare applied gold "Golden Gazelle" emblem sits proudly above the 6 o'clock mark. A date window is positioned at 3 o'clock, displaying red numerals for a pop of contrast. The hands are baton-style with black center inserts, remaining in excellent condition.
Case and Crystal
The stainless steel case features a distinctive tonneau shape with integrated lugs, showcasing the sharp, angular geometry typical of the era. The upper surfaces retain their original radial brushing, while the sides are polished, creating a crisp definition between planes. A standout feature is the fluted bezel ring, which remains sharp and catches the light effectively. The crystal is clear and free of distracting marks. The screw-down caseback is deeply engraved with the Rado Seahorse logo and clearly visible serial numbers.
Movement
Powering the watch is a Swiss-made Rado signed automatic movement with 25 jewels. The rotor is clean and clearly engraved. The watch is currently functioning, with timegrapher results showing a deviation of approximately -39 to -45 seconds per day, indicating the movement is running complete and operational.
Strap
The watch comes fitted with its original integrated stainless steel link bracelet. The bracelet matches the finish of the case perfectly and features a signed Rado deployant clasp with an embossed anchor logo. It is sized to fit a wrist of approximately 19cm comfortably.

History
Rado has long been celebrated for its innovative use of materials and distinct design language. Throughout the mid-20th century, the brand established itself as a leader in creating durable and stylish waterproof watches, symbolized by the Seahorse and Anchor logos. The Golden Gazelle represents a period where Rado experimented with bold case shapes and integrated bracelets, cementing their reputation for avant-garde styling that remains collectible today.
